Output 6881ab1977d60c697668ff9bcd55c9073611a04bf6c12fc03c3e21a542d6565b:1

value
250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d32596f1f9162aee28e7e2384b740eac2873baa5 OP_EQUALVERIFY OP_CHECKSIG
address
1LFScFUFGWiBSWftyFw21yGHiY9z8fKTFH
transaction
6881ab1977d60c697668ff9bcd55c9073611a04bf6c12fc03c3e21a542d6565b
spent
true